Bullish RSI Divergence — The Key Confirmation Signal
The most analytically significant element of @CryptoBullet1’s chart is not the support trendline itself — it is what the RSI is doing in the lower panel while price tests that support.
A bullish RSI divergence has formed on the weekly chart:
Price action: Making lower lows — SUI’s corrective phase from the 2025 ATH has been producing successive lower price lows
RSI reading: Making higher lows — while price declined to new corrective lows, the RSI has been printing progressively higher readings at each successive low
This divergence — price lower, RSI higher — is one of the most classically documented reversal signals in technical analysis. It indicates that selling pressure is weakening at each successive price low — fewer sellers are participating in the decline, even as price makes new corrective lows. The momentum behind the downtrend is deteriorating.
Bullish RSI divergences on weekly charts — which represent a multi-month development rather than a single-session reading — carry substantially more analytical weight than the same pattern on shorter timeframes.
